แสดงคุณสมบัติเอกสารใน Excel โดยใช้ Python

หัวข้อนี้ครอบคลุมถึงวิธีการ แสดงคุณสมบัติของเอกสารใน Excel โดยใช้ Python โดยครอบคลุมรายละเอียดเพื่อกำหนดค่า IDE สำหรับการใช้คุณสมบัตินี้ รายการขั้นตอนการเขียนโปรแกรมเพื่อให้งานสำเร็จ และโค้ดตัวอย่างที่แสดง คุณสมบัติไฟล์ Excel ที่ใช้ Python คุณยังจะได้รับความรู้ในการเข้าถึงคุณสมบัติในตัวและคุณสมบัติแบบกำหนดเองโดยใช้อาร์กิวเมนต์ที่แตกต่างกันเป็นพารามิเตอร์

ขั้นตอนในการแสดงคุณสมบัติเอกสารใน Excel โดยใช้ Python

  1. ตั้งค่า IDE เพื่อใช้ Aspose.Cells สำหรับ Python ผ่าน Java เพื่ออ่านคุณสมบัติ
  2. เปิดไฟล์ Excel ต้นฉบับลงในคลาส Workbook เพื่อแสดงคุณสมบัติ
  3. วนซ้ำคุณสมบัติเอกสารแบบกำหนดเองทั้งหมดในสมุดงาน และแสดงชื่อคุณสมบัติและค่าในคอนโซลเอาต์พุต
  4. วนซ้ำ builtin properties ทั้งหมด รวมถึงชื่อที่แสดงและค่าในคอนโซลเอาต์พุต
  5. เข้าถึงคุณสมบัติอื่น ๆ มากมายโดยใช้ชื่อคุณสมบัติหรือดัชนี

ขั้นตอนข้างต้นอธิบายสั้นๆ วิธีแสดงคุณสมบัติเอกสารใน Excel โดยใช้ Python เข้าถึงไฟล์ Excel ต้นทาง วนซ้ำคุณสมบัติแบบกำหนดเอง/ในตัวทั้งหมด และส่งออกคุณสมบัติบางอย่าง เช่น ชื่อและค่า เข้าถึงคุณสมบัติเอกสารแต่ละรายการโดยใช้ชื่อคุณสมบัติหรือดัชนีตามความต้องการ

รหัสเพื่อแสดงคุณสมบัติเอกสาร Excel โดยใช้ Python

import jpype
import asposecells
jpype.startJVM()
from asposecells.api import License, Workbook, CustomDocumentPropertyCollection, DocumentProperty, BuiltInDocumentPropertyCollection
# Instantiate product license
License().setLicense("License.lic")
# Load source Workbook file
wb = Workbook("sample.xlsx")
for custProp in workbook.getCustomDocumentProperties():
print("Workbook Custom Property Name: " + custProp.getName() + ", Value = " + custProp.getValue())
for builtInProp in workbook.getBuiltInDocumentProperties():
print("Workbook Builtin Property Name: " + builtInProp.getName() + ", Value = " + builtInProp.getValue())
# fetch a list of all builtin document properties of the Excel file
builtinProperties = workbook.getBuiltInDocumentProperties()
# Access a builtin document property by using the property name
builtinProperty = builtinProperties.get("Author")
print(builtinProperty.getName() + " " + builtinProperty.getValue())
# Access the same builtin document property by using the property index
builtinProperty = builtinProperties.get(0)
print(builtinProperty.getName() + " " + builtinProperty.getValue())
print("Done")
jpype.shutdownJVM()

โค้ดตัวอย่างนี้ได้แสดง วิธีการแสดงคุณสมบัติใน Excel โดยใช้ Python สิ่งสำคัญที่ต้องกล่าวถึงคือคุณสมบัติแบบกำหนดเองจะแสดงขึ้นหากมีอยู่ในไฟล์ Excel อย่างไรก็ตาม คุณสมบัติในตัวจะแสดงตามค่าเริ่มต้นเสมอ ในการจัดการคุณสมบัติแต่ละรายการ คุณสามารถใช้คุณสมบัติในตัวอื่นๆ เช่น LastSavedBy, Author, CreateTime, LastSavedTime, Version ฯลฯ

หัวข้อนี้ให้ความกระจ่างแก่เราในการเข้าถึงและแสดงคุณสมบัติในไฟล์ Excel หากต้องการลบตัวแบ่งหน้าในไฟล์ Excel โปรดดูบทความเกี่ยวกับ ลบตัวแบ่งหน้าใน Excel โดยใช้ Python

 ไทย